Ticket: Holiday opening hours, Dunmoor Court site. Over the holiday period the main entrance is closed; contractors must use the east service door between 08:00 and 16:00 only. No weekend access. Sign in at the wall register inside the door and wear hi-vis on the concourse. Waste skips are locked; raise a separate ticket if access is needed. Security patrols hourly, so expect checks. The east service door keypad accepts the code below.

turnstile pass: bdg-FVNQRS-72965873

ALERT: The Skylark device-firmware update channel reported a checksum mismatch on three consecutive rollout batches. Affected devices automatically rolled back to the previous firmware, so no fleet impact is expected. New team members: do not retry the rollout manually; the channel locks until the artifact is re-signed. For unlock requests, contact the firmware release team.

alerts address for kajog-tadup: druox@plorvanet.internal

Hi Priya — handing off on-call for Lanternfold. The incremental static rebuild queue backed up twice this week; both times it was a stuck content-hash worker. Restarting the builder pod clears it. Full rebuilds still take ~40 minutes, so avoid triggering one during peak hours. If the queue stalls again overnight, reach out to the build-platform owner directly.

escalation mailbox, faweg-yahop: casax@lumiccorp.corp